What are the main differences between cream cracker and succotash?

  • Cream cracker is richer in iron, folate, vitamin B3, vitamin B12, selenium, vitamin B2, and vitamin B1, yet succotash is richer in copper.
  • Cream cracker's daily need coverage for iron is 69% higher.
  • Succotash contains less sodium.

We used Crackers, cream, GAMESA SABROSAS and Succotash, (corn and limas), raw types in this comparison.
